  • In the context of the Strategy and Action Plan, DG HOME commissioned a Flash Eurobarometer survey to evaluate the impact of drugs on communities in the EU. This survey builds on the work of previous reports (Flash Eurobarometer 401 of 2014, Flash Eurobarometer 330 in 2011, Flash Eurobarometer 233 in 2008, Flash Eurobarometer 158 in 2004, Special Eurobarometer 172 in 2002) which focused on perceptions about and attitudes towards drugs of young people in particular. Specifically, the survey covered the following topics: The extent to which drug use and dealing is seen to be problematic in local communities - and the perceived prevalence of associated issues and problems; The perceived link between drug use and crime ; The impact of drugs on health and well-being, including quality of life in local areas ; Attitudes to cannabis, including whether it should be allowed for medical and recreational use ; Opinions on the sale and regulation of drugs in the Member States ; The perceived ease with which different types of drugs can be obtained for personal use. Ipsos European Public Affairs interviewed a representative sample of EU citizens, aged 15 and over, in each of the 27 Member States of the European Union. Between 30 June and 10 July 2021, 25 713 people were surveyed via computer-assisted telephone interviewing (CATI), using Random Digit Dialling (RDD) and a dual frame (landline and mobile) probability design. Survey data are weighted to known population proportions. The EU27 averages are weighted according to the size of the 15+ population of each EU Member State. A technical note on the methods applied to conduct the survey is appended as an annex to this report. Fieldwork for this Flash Eurobarometer took place in June-July 2021 when the COVID-19 pandemic and corresponding measures were still ongoing, the perceptions of respondents could have been impacted on a wide range of topics.
